kink wrote:Thanks, I found out the fronts were too high and the rears too short. What industry standard? They are all different :D
How much too long or short? I think differences up to 5mm or so are easily changed by adding spacers inside the shock pistons and/or changing ball ends. You can increase a shock length even more easily just by changing the ball ends.
